The Monster’s Bones: How the Discovery of T. Rex Changed Our Culture
In the dust of the Gilded Age Bone Wars, two men emerged with a mission to fill the empty halls of the American Museum of Natural History. Kansas-born paleontologist Barnum Brown was one of these men. Brown helped bring dinosaurs into popular culture through a life of fossil hunting, and when he unearthed the first T. Rex fossil, he forever changed the world of paleontology. In The Monster’s Bones, David K. Randall reveals how a monster of a bygone era ignited a new understanding of our planet and our place within it.
